Crawford and his family have been long term residents of Central Ward. He has a strong belief in keeping our Central Ward suburbs of Ardross, Booragoon, Myaree and Winthrop safe and family friendly.
He is a lawyer with two young children attending a local Central Ward school and participating in local community sport.
Crawford believes in working for community and ensuring that Council spends wisely on essential local government core services and infrastructure. He has interests in keeping Council rate rises at or below inflation, community safety, sensible housing densities and increasing verge tree canopy.
Crawford considers support to local sporting and community groups a priority as these volunteer run organisations are a vital and cost-effective way to increase the wellbeing of our community.He can often be seen getting injured playing masters league football for the Brentwood Booragoon Bulldogs at Karoonda Reserve.
